Output 24af85f7e18dcd7b389917f2b2e90af0e5d70327495b8a526cb63a7242848725:1

value
149437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877a17585ecb629bce5b0a9dfc21e47a4a504c56 OP_EQUALVERIFY OP_CHECKSIG
address
1DMLUwdQXtTB6DFwkKqth6rBkLYtzUbmEq
transaction
24af85f7e18dcd7b389917f2b2e90af0e5d70327495b8a526cb63a7242848725
spent
true